Which of the following statements best describes a chemical change?
- A substance changes its state from solid to liquid.
- A substance undergoes a transformation that results in the formation of one or more new substances.
- A substance is dissolved in a solvent.
- A substance is mixed with another substance without altering its composition.
Correct Answer:
B
Explanation
**Correct Option: B. A substance undergoes a transformation that results in the formation of one or more new substances.**
### Detailed Explanation:
To understand why option B is the correct answer, we first need to define what a chemical change is. A chemical change, also known as a chemical reaction, occurs when one or more substances (reactants) are transformed into one or more different substances (products). This transformation involves breaking and forming chemical bonds, which results in a change in the chemical composition of the substances involved.
#### Why Option B is Correct:
- **Formation of New Substances**: In a chemical change, the original substances undergo a transformation that results in new substances with different properties. For example, when hydrogen gas reacts with oxygen gas to form water, the properties of water are entirely different from those of hydrogen and oxygen.
- **Indicators of Chemical Change**: There are often observable signs of a chemical change, such as color change, gas production (bubbles), temperature change (exothermic or endothermic reactions), and the formation of a precipitate (a solid that forms from a solution). These indicators suggest that a new substance has been formed.
#### Why the Other Options are Incorrect or Weaker:
- **Option A: A substance changes its state from solid to liquid.**
- This describes a **physical change**, not a chemical change. In a physical change, the substance may change its state (like melting or freezing), but its chemical composition remains the same. For example, when ice melts to become water, it is still H₂O, just in a different state.
- **Option C: A substance is dissolved in a solvent.**
- This also describes a **physical change**. When a substance dissolves, such as salt in water, the individual particles separate but do not change their chemical identity. The salt (NaCl) remains NaCl, even though it is in a solution.
- **Option D: A substance is mixed with another substance without altering its composition.**
- This statement describes a **physical mixture** rather than a chemical change. When two substances are mixed without any chemical reaction occurring, they retain their individual properties and compositions. For example, mixing sand and salt results in a mixture where both components can be separated and retain their original properties.
